Essential oils (also called volatile oils) generally extracted by distillation from plants are hydrophobic liquids containing volatile aromatic compounds. The essential oils are widely used in perfumes, cosmetics as well as in food and drink as flavor additives. Some essential oils show multiple pharmacological activities and have been considered as the major active fractions of herbal medicines [1–3]. Preparative separation of the volatile components is very important not only for the quality control of the crude herbs and the products containing the essential oil but also for the bio-evaluation. China Curcuma wenyujin using high-performance centrifugal partition chromatography Received June 29 2009 Revised January 20 2010 Accepted February 23 2010 Six volatile compounds curdione 1 curcumol 2 germacrone 3 curzerene 4 1 8-cineole 5 and P-elemene 6 were successfully isolated from the essential oil of Curcuma wenyujin by high-performance centrifugal partition chromatography using a nonaqueous two-phase solvent system consisting of petroleum ether-acetonitrile-acetone 4 3 1 v v v . A total of 8 mg of curdione 1 4 mg of curcumol 2 10 mg of germacrone 3 18 mg of curzerene 4 9 mg of 1 8-cineole 5 and 17 mg of P-elemene 6 were isolated from the essential oil 300 mg in 500 min. Their structures were determined by comparison of their retention times and MS data with those of the authentic samples as well as NMR spectroscopic analysis.
